Short Description | Additional error code info |
Description
In case of an error ERRCODE !=0 this variable gets an additional information about the errcor cause. At the drive the ERRCODE2 is displayed with an i followed by the number. | ||
Status | Error | description |
ERRCODE2 = 0 | - | no additional information |
ERRCODE2 = 1 | F32 | system fault software watchdog |
ERRCODE2 = 2 | F32 | system fault: wrong order oth the commandtable |
ERRCODE2 = 3 | F32 | system fault: macro conversion fault |
ERRCODE2 = 4 | - | reserved |
ERRCODE2 = 5 | F25 | commutation fault: velocity control |
ERRCODE2 = 6 | F25 | commutation fault: current control |
ERRCODE2 = 7 | F25 | commutation fault: wrong segment of the Hall feedback |
ERRCODE2 = 8 | F25 | commutation fault: W&S contouring error |
ERRCODE2 = 9 | F25 | commutation fault: amplitude of W&S to high |
ERRCODE2 = 10 | F25 | commutation fault: amplitude of W&S to small |
ERRCODE2 = 11 | F25 | commutation fault: W&S IQ to high |
ERRCODE2 = 12 | F25 | commutation fault: W&S wrong average |
ERRCODE2 = 13 | F07 | The gate voltage of the IGBT drivers is missing (internal hardware error). |
ERRCODE2 = 14 | F07 | The 15V power supply voltage is missing (internal hardware error). |
ERRCODE2 = 15 | F32 | The firmware version is not suitable for the plugged in option card. |
ERRCODE2 = 16 | F04 | Error while reading the BISS-position in regsiter mode. |
ERRCODE2 = 17 | - | reserved |
ERRCODE2 = 18 | F04 | BISS communication fault. |
ERRCODE2 = 19 | - | reserved |
ERRCODE2 = 20 | F25 | Sine/Cosine amplitude is too large |
ERRCODE2 = 21 | F07 | 15V power-supply is missing (only for 748/772) |
ERRCODE2 = 22 | F04 | Reading the encoder data via slow data access was not possible (communication problem with the encoder) |
ERRCODE2 = 23 | F04 | Reading the encoder data via fast data access was not possible (communication problem with the encoder) |
ERRCODE2 = 24 | - | reserved |
ERRCODE2 = 25 | F20 | Reading data from the POSIO option-card was not possible. see also CALCPOSIO |
ERRCODE2 = 26 | - | reserved |
ERRCODE2 = 27 | F32 | Corrupted flash data for the amplifier identification number. |
ERRCODE2 = 28 | F04 | Determination of the BISS-C frame length has failed. |
ERRCODE2 = 29 | F29 | The plugged in option card does not match with the software version of the drive. |
ERRCODE2 = 30 | F29 | A software enable command coming from the option-card failed since the hardware enable signal is missing or the DC bus voltage is too low. |
ERRCODE2 = 31 | F29 | The hardware enable signal has been removed while the option-card was in operation and has enabled the drive. Hardware enable signal is lost or the bus voltage is too low. |
ERRCODE2 = 32 | F29 | Either the drive was not able to get synchronized with the cyclic command values from the fieldbus during the phase run-up procedure or the synchronization was getting lost while the option card was in operational mode. |
ERRCODE2 = 33 | F29 | The option-card requested a CLRFAULT (clear faults) command during a pending fault. This CLRFAULT command command would lead to a software reset of the drive. This monitoring needs to be activated via the command SERCSET and is only available for specific option-cards. |
ERRCODE2 = 34 | F29 | The EtherCAT master requested a state transition from the Operational state to another state although the drive has been enabled (software enable = true). The drive has lost the synchronization with the EtherCAT cyclic command values if this fault comes along with a F28 fault. |
ERRCODE2 = 35 | F29 | The mapping number of the command-value mapping, which has been previously transmitted to the drive via SDO, is unknown. |
ERRCODE2 = 36 | F29 | The mapping number of the actual-value mapping, which has been previously transmitted to the drive via SDO, is unknown. |
ERRCODE2 = 37 | F29 | The length of the command-value mapping in bytes assumed by the EtherCAT master does not match with the length of the mapping assumed by the drive. |
ERRCODE2 = 38 | F29 | The length of the actual-value mapping in bytes assumed by the EtherCAT master does not match with the length of the mapping assumed by the drive. |
ERRCODE2 = 39 | F29 | The option card indicates a card error or network fault. This status message is only indicated by specific option-cards. |
ERRCODE2 = 40 | F29 | The SynqNet master has selected an invalid resolution of the velocity scaling/unit via direct commands. |
ERRCODE2 = 41 | F29 | The mode of operation selected by the Sercos master does not match the mode of operation in the drive (OPMODE).. |
ERRCODE2 = 42 | F29 | The Sercos interrupt function detected a broken network cable. |
ERRCODE2 = 43 | F29 | The drive has detected several consecutive missing MTS (master synchronization telegrams). |
ERRCODE2 = 44 | F29 | The drive has detected an unknown/invalid Sercos interrupt type. |
ERRCODE2 = 45 | F29 | The drive identified a Sercos ASIC with an unknown/invalid version number. |
ERRCODE2 = 46 | F29 | The drive has identified an error condition in the object IDN14. |
ERRCODE2 = 47 | F29 | The FireWire option card has not updated the watchdog counter value. |
ERRCODE2 = 48 | F29 | The Modbus+ card has stopped generating interrupt signals |
ERRCODE2 = 49 | F29 | The EtherNet card has stopped its SDO transfer. |
ERRCODE2 = 50 | F14 | overflow of the current measurement |
ERRCODE2 = 51 | F18 | regen fault (hardware) |
ERRCODE2 = 52 | F18 | max. mechnaic power of the regen reached |
ERRCODE2 = 53 | F04 | min. resolver amplitude (threshold) undershot |
ERRCODE2 = 54 | F04 | max. amplitude jump of the resolver signals |
ERRCODE2 = 55 | F04 | phase deviation between sinus/cosinus of the resolver |
